Transaction 305895a02d32692ef1d2e5a493a9c4e5b906c1ad0087f6399d25116fd385ab01
1 Input
1 Output
-
305895a02d32692ef1d2e5a493a9c4e5b906c1ad0087f6399d25116fd385ab01:0
- value
- 4952303
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3356445dd5465668a329678d371b28bc8b376995 OP_EQUAL
- address
- 36NTjGTRMaR1eMFgkCZVkBGjhnrn2iZPbs